Brookfield Resident Charged In New York With DWI: State Police

New York State police said three Connecticut drivers were arrested in the town of Southeast Dec. 8.

SOUTHEAST, NY — New York State Police in Troop K said they removed 22 impaired drivers from the public roadways during the Dec. 7, weekend. Among them were two men from Danbury and a Brookfield resident, all of whom were stopped Dec. 8 in the town of Southeast, New York.

  • New York State police from Brewster arrested Joseph R. Dilascio, 21, of Brookfield, CT, on a charge of Driving While Intoxicated. He was traveling on State Route 6 in the town of Southeast when he was stopped for a violation of the vehicle and traffic law. Investigation revealed he was under the influence of alcohol, police alleged.
  • New York state troopers arrested Jhon J. Penaherrera, 19, of Danbury, CT, on a charge of DWI. He was traveling on State Route 6 in Southeast when he was stopped for a violation of the vehicle and traffic law. Investigation revealed he was under the influence of alcohol, police said.
  • State troopers arrested Sergio V. Castro Torres, 45, of Danbury, CT, for DWI. He was traveling on North Salem Road in Southeast, when he was stopped for a violation of the vehicle and traffic law. Investigation revealed he was under the influence of alcohol, police alleged.
